Egon Hilbert

Austrian theatrical manager and director of the Vienna State Opera (1964-1968)

Egon Hilbert

Summary

Egon Hilbert is a human[1]. His place of birth was Vienna[2]. He was born on +1899-05-19T00:00:00Z[3]. He passed away in Vienna[4]. He died on +1968-01-18T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a conductor[6].
